About Aijun Xing

Aijun Xing is a scholar working on Cardiology and Cardiovascular Medicine, Soil Science, Ecology, Nature and Landscape Conservation and Global and Planetary Change, having authored 63 papers that have together received 1.5k indexed citations. Recurring topics across this work include Soil Carbon and Nitrogen Dynamics (17 papers), Ecology and Vegetation Dynamics Studies (8 papers), Cardiovascular Health and Disease Prevention (7 papers), Cardiovascular Health and Risk Factors (7 papers), Peatlands and Wetlands Ecology (6 papers), Plant Water Relations and Carbon Dynamics (5 papers), Blood Pressure and Hypertension Studies (5 papers) and Microbial Community Ecology and Physiology (5 papers). The work is most often cited by research in Soil Science (525 citations), Cardiology and Cardiovascular Medicine (321 citations), Ecology (313 citations), Environmental Chemistry (119 citations) and Nature and Landscape Conservation (134 citations). Aijun Xing has collaborated with scholars based in China, United States and Romania. Frequent co-authors include Haihua Shen, Jingyun Fang, Shouling Wu, Longchao Xu, Luhong Zhou, Shuohua Chen, Mengying Zhao, Suhui Ma, Yuntao Wu and Shangshi Liu. Their work appears in journals such as Environmental Pollution, PLoS ONE, Plant and Soil, Journal of the American Heart Association and Functional Ecology.
